Bounce Rate is Percentage of people who leaves a particular website just after visiting a single page is called Bounce Rate.
Bounce Rate = (Visits With Only 1 Pageview) / (Total Visits) |

Bounce rate is the percentage of single page visits (or web sessions). It is the number of visits in which a person leaves your website from the landing page without browsing any further. Google analytics calculates and reports the bounce rate of a web page and bounce rate of a website.
